форкнуто от main/python-labs
Вы не можете выбрать более 25 тем
Темы должны начинаться с буквы или цифры, могут содержать дефисы(-) и должны содержать не более 35 символов.
30 строки
954 B
Python
30 строки
954 B
Python
import pickle
|
|
|
|
spis = ["Бушманов", "Подольский", "Жалнин", "Голощапов", "Таболин"]
|
|
kort = (5000, 200000, 120000, 70000, 60000)
|
|
|
|
company = input(" Введите название фирмы (латиницей): ")
|
|
company = company.replace(' ', '')
|
|
print(" Название фирмы:", company)
|
|
|
|
# Создаем словарь с именем компании как ключом
|
|
company_dict = {
|
|
company: dict(zip(spis, kort))
|
|
}
|
|
|
|
print("Словарь фирмы:")
|
|
print(company_dict)
|
|
|
|
average_salary = sum(kort) / len(kort)
|
|
print(f" Средний оклад сотрудников: {average_salary:.2f} рублей")
|
|
|
|
# Создаем имя файла из названия компании
|
|
filename = f"{company}.bin"
|
|
fp = open(filename, 'wb')
|
|
pickle.dump(spis, fp)
|
|
pickle.dump(kort, fp)
|
|
pickle.dump(company_dict, fp)
|
|
fp.close()
|
|
|
|
print(f" Данные сохранены в файл: {filename}")
|